About The Position The Geneva Foundation is recruiting a Post-Doctoral Fellow to join a cutting-edge research team advancing Military Brain Health at USU's Department of Radiology and Bioengineering. This is an embedded role on-site at WRNMMC, co-located with USU at National Support Activity Bethesda. As a nonprofit partner, Geneva receives and administers federal awards for research conducted directly at DoD installations, serving as a dedicated supporter of federal researchers and a trusted partner in military medical research. The Post-Doctoral Fellow will develop high-sensitivity, quantitative, and multiparametric MR imaging methods to study neurotrauma and mild cognitive impairment, evaluate their reproducibility, and accelerate their clinical translation.…
